Output d66e613dd29fb41e71e3e4c3e30e1750b13c5790077c06fea4c2e4ad562c4f6b:0

value
298988336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59bc8ab8fd30f36a426ea4458119f90ade33358 OP_EQUAL
address
3Nd5HXT6SP2qsw9K5ngbUTWg6nXmUhtatt
transaction
d66e613dd29fb41e71e3e4c3e30e1750b13c5790077c06fea4c2e4ad562c4f6b
spent
true